Transaction e8760c4186868bc232937ed4e44238903a5412de31922e8e3231f50aea50696d
1 Input
1 Output
-
e8760c4186868bc232937ed4e44238903a5412de31922e8e3231f50aea50696d:0
- value
- 307413
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6688429523b9cd7f7c39799677d933a6e7abb8f6 OP_EQUAL
- address
- 3B3A5dLhFzXUbATpchE1N8TXS1ZV7eoHNF